Crocodiles Take Down Zebra in Epic Kenyan River Battle (Circle of Life)
foxnews ^ | November 14, 2008

Posted on 11/14/2008 10:42:16 AM PST by JoeProBono

A hungry crocodile appears to have bitten off more than it could chew in an attack on a zebra captured on film Thursday at the Masai Mara game reserve in south-western Kenya, The Daily Mail reported.

A group of zebras attempted to cross the Mara river in the reserve when a crocodile leapt from the water, biting the zebra's head.
